优化加载序列:解锁网站极速资源加载与巅峰性能
|
现代网站性能优化的关键之一,在于对加载序列的精确控制。加载顺序不当,不仅会导致资源浪费,还会显著影响用户体验。通过科学地安排脚本、样式表、图片以及其他关键资源的加载顺序,可以有效缩短用户感知的加载时间,提升页面交互速度。
2025AI生成的计划图,仅供参考 页面渲染过程是一个复杂的流水线操作,资源加载顺序决定了这一流程的效率。将关键CSS内联、延迟非首屏JavaScript、优先加载可视区域内容,都是优化加载序列的重要策略。这些做法有助于浏览器更高效地构建渲染树,避免不必要的阻塞。采用资源优先级标记机制,是提升加载效率的有力手段。通过`rel=\"preload\"`和`rel=\"prefetch\"`等HTML属性,开发者可以明确告诉浏览器哪些资源应优先加载,哪些可以在空闲时预加载。这种控制方式不仅提升了性能,也增强了资源调度的智能性。 图片资源的加载优化,往往能带来立竿见影的性能提升。延迟加载(Lazy Loading)技术可以让图片仅在进入可视区域时才开始加载,从而减少初始请求量。结合`loading=\"lazy\"`属性与合适的占位符策略,可以在不牺牲体验的前提下,显著提升页面加载效率。 JavaScript的执行时机对加载序列有深远影响。异步加载和延迟执行技术可以避免脚本阻塞页面渲染。合理使用`async`和`defer`属性,确保脚本在不影响关键渲染路径的前提下执行,是优化加载顺序的重要环节。 利用现代浏览器的预加载扫描器,也是优化加载流程的重要方面。预加载扫描器能够提前发现并下载关键资源,但前提是HTML结构必须清晰、语义明确。通过优化HTML结构、合理组织资源引用顺序,可以最大化利用浏览器的预加载能力。 HTTP/2与服务器推送技术为加载序列优化提供了新的可能。通过服务器端主动推送关键资源,可以减少往返请求,提升首次渲染速度。然而,这一技术需要谨慎使用,避免推送过多非关键资源导致带宽浪费。 性能监控与持续优化是保障加载序列长期有效的关键。借助Lighthouse、PageSpeed Insights等工具,可以定期评估加载行为,识别瓶颈。通过真实用户性能数据(RUM)分析,可进一步优化加载策略,使其更贴近实际使用场景。 (编辑:92站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

